+.TH KRB_SET_TKT_STRING 3 "Kerberos Version 4.0" "MIT Project Athena"
+.SH NAME
+krb_set_tkt_string \- set Kerberos ticket cache file name
+.SH SYNOPSIS
+.nf
+.nj
+.ft B
+#include <krb.h>
+.PP
+.ft B
+void krb_set_tkt_string(filename)
+char *filename;
+.fi
+.ft R
+.SH DESCRIPTION
+.I krb_set_tkt_string
+sets the name of the file that holds the user's
+cache of Kerberos server tickets and associated session keys.
+.PP
+The string
+.I filename
+passed in is copied into local storage.
+Only MAXPATHLEN-1 (see <sys/param.h>) characters of the filename are
+copied in for use as the cache file name.
+.PP
+This routine should be called during initialization, before other
+Kerberos routines are called; otherwise the routines which fetch the
+ticket cache file name may be called and return an undesired ticket file
+name until this routine is called.
+.SH FILES
+.TP 20n
+/tmp/tkt[uid]
+default ticket file name, unless the environment variable KRBTKFILE is set.
+[uid] denotes the user's uid, in decimal.
